# HG changeset patch # User Silverwing # Date 2019-03-02 09:53:03 # Node ID e7cdff886e36a307a26a9823d6bb24a4943c0f65 # Parent b168d439d9a0c72e7c1fba1bc7961640bf5e9242 [fix] remove unneeded files from executable package diff --git a/build.sh b/build.sh --- a/build.sh +++ b/build.sh @@ -3,13 +3,14 @@ VERSION="1.0.0" pyrcc5 pics/pics.qrc -o pics/__init__.py rm kcdemu.zip -zip -r kcdemu.zip ./ -x \*.png \*.ui .hg\* .idea\* build.sh +zip -r kcdemu.zip ./ -x \*.png \*.ui .hg\* .idea\* build.sh ./packaging/\* \*.pyc \*__pycache__\* mkdir build mkdir build/temp # Debian/Ubuntu mkdir build/temp/debian cp -r packaging/debian/* build/temp/debian +mkdir -p build/temp/debian/opt/kcdemu/ cp kcdemu.zip build/temp/debian/opt/kcdemu/ CONTROL=`cat build/temp/debian/DEBIAN/control` CONTROL=`echo "${CONTROL//%VERSION%/$VERSION}"`